Transaction 03582184653f50421e14694a5dd66c785867f5dbee1d5c8270f3d8c4314620ea
1 Input
1 Output
-
03582184653f50421e14694a5dd66c785867f5dbee1d5c8270f3d8c4314620ea:0
- value
- 12753072
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9240a6a9caeb45e98be116bb6cc1d8607dcd00b2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ELK73HgGe339CGChZYsqDoiFgaSEmB2aV